Transaction 80f4d7a2cbb0e4159d27a60c97613f1922dc974dd38818998fef385bde3e9968
1 Input
1 Output
-
80f4d7a2cbb0e4159d27a60c97613f1922dc974dd38818998fef385bde3e9968:0
- value
- 5530445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d5f58777de2336c15644f0d5a96076037150eed OP_EQUAL
- address
- 3BfKoBPEvD9pb6V2zrxkn4DLbyggULgxjN